*,*:before,*:after{box-sizing:border-box}html,body{margin:0;padding:0;font-family:monospace;overscroll-behavior:none}.Home{display:flex;flex-direction:column;height:100vh;height:100dvh;padding-top:env(safe-area-inset-top);padding-left:env(safe-area-inset-left);padding-right:env(safe-area-inset-right)}.Home>.content{display:flex;flex:1;min-height:0}.Home>.content>.main{flex:1;display:flex;flex-direction:column;min-width:0}.Home>.content>.main>.header{padding:.5em;border-bottom:1px solid #ccc;font-size:14px;display:flex;justify-content:space-between;align-items:center}.Home>.content>.main>.header>.channel{font-weight:700}.Home>.content>.main>.header>.connection-status{background:none;border:none;font-family:monospace;font-size:12px;padding:.25em .5em;opacity:1;transition:opacity 1s ease-out}.Home>.content>.main>.header>.connection-status>.status-text{display:inline-block;width:12ch;text-align:center}.Home>.content>.main>.header>.connection-status.disconnected{color:#c00;cursor:pointer}.Home>.content>.main>.header>.connection-status.clickable:hover>.status-text{text-decoration:underline;color:#000}.Home>.content>.main>.header>.connection-status.connecting{color:#000;cursor:wait}.Home>.content>.main>.header>.connection-status.reconnected{color:#0a0;cursor:default}.Home>.content>.main>.void{flex:1;display:flex;flex-direction:column;justify-content:center;align-items:center;text-align:center;padding:2em;color:#666;font-style:italic;line-height:1.5}.Home>.content>.main>.void>.hint{margin-top:0;font-style:normal;color:#999}.Home>.content>.main>.void>.hint:first-of-type{margin-top:1em}.Home>.content>.main>.void .channel-link{color:#1a4971;cursor:pointer;text-decoration:none;background:#e3f2fd;border:1px solid #b3d9f2;border-radius:4px;padding:.1em .4em}.Home>.content>.main>.void .channel-link:hover{background:#d0e8f7}.Home>.content>.main>.void>.notice{margin-top:1.5em;color:#000;font-weight:500;font-style:italic}.Home>.content>.main>.header>.menu-button{display:none;background:none;border:none;font-size:1.5em;cursor:pointer;padding:.25em;margin-right:.5em}.Home>.content>.main>.header>.menu-button:focus{outline:2px solid #e3f2fd;outline-offset:1px}@media(max-width:600px){.Home>.content>.ChannelList{display:none;position:fixed;top:0;left:0;bottom:0;width:80%;max-width:280px;z-index:100;background:#fff;box-shadow:2px 0 8px #0003;padding-top:env(safe-area-inset-top);padding-bottom:env(safe-area-inset-bottom);padding-left:env(safe-area-inset-left)}.Home>.content>.ChannelList.open{display:flex}.Home>.backdrop{display:none;position:fixed;inset:0;background:#0000004d;z-index:99}.Home>.backdrop.open{display:block}.Home>.content>.main>.header>.menu-button{display:flex;align-items:center;gap:.25em}.Home>.content>.main>.header{padding-top:calc(.5em - 2.5px);padding-bottom:calc(.5em - 2px)}}.Home>.content>.main>.header>.menu-button>.menu-badge{display:none}@media(max-width:600px){.Home>.content>.main>.header>.menu-button>.menu-badge{display:inline-block;font-size:.65em;font-weight:700;background:#888;color:#fff;padding:.1em .4em;border-radius:.8em;min-width:1.2em;text-align:center}.Home>.content>.main>.header>.menu-button>.menu-badge.mention{background:#c44}}
